The Stepson I Thought Hated Me Was Protecting My Husband’s Last Wish

 

I thought my stepson hated me after my husband died. Tyler cut all contact—then returned a year later carrying a box filled with photos, letters, and my missing wedding ring.

“I wasn’t avoiding you,” he said. “I was protecting you.”

Inside was my husband’s journal revealing secrets he had hidden to spare me from fear. Tyler had also worked two jobs and used the life insurance to save our home from foreclosure.

He was only a teenager, yet he had quietly protected everything his father loved—including me. The boy I thought had abandoned me had been carrying our family all along.

Sometimes, the people who disappear aren’t walking away. They’re quietly clearing a path back to you.
